Small California Town Rises to Second in State’s Murder Rate Rankings

Is Emeryville a Paradise That Has Been Lost?

The year 2023 witnessed a horrific rise in the level of violence in Emeryville. There were a remarkable six hundred percent increase in the number of killings that took place in this little community of approximately 13,000 people compared to the three that took place the previous year. Because of this, Emeryville has a shockingly high rate of violent crime, which is 161.54 per 1,000 residents. This places Emeryville as the second most dangerous city in the state of California. Oakland continues to lead the state with a rate of 127 per 1,000 people, but Emeryville’s surprising increase has taken both the locals and law enforcement by surprise. Oakland’s rate is the highest the state has ever seen.

A variety of people, ranging from young IT professionals to senior residents, have been victims of a variety of violent acts, including targeted assassinations as well as acts of violence that appear to be random. Adding to the public’s anxiety is the fact that a significant number of cases have not yet been settled. There is a palpable sense of uneasiness in place of the once-secure environment that existed inside a community that is closely tied together. It has been reported by a significant number of residents that they are becoming more cautious and avoiding venturing out by themselves, particularly after dark.
